"The unit itself is well styled, sleek looking with graphics running diagonally across the unit. It looks and feels well built and the touch screen works well with a gloved hand.
I have mounted mine on the out front bracket that came with the bundle and it is easy to access without getting in the way of anything and looks fab. It took about 10mins max to install the sensor and magnets, no dramas.
The cadence and heart rate monitor were easy to install and pair with the unit, as was my i-phone for live tracking with the garmin connect app. The instructions are intuitive and in around 10 minutes I was riding with everything set up and scrolling through the menu to see the different screens.
Uploading to Garmin select is simple, as is setting up live track so that others can see where you are. Posting to social network also really easy and all this from a 49 year old technophobe!
the only negative was the cost, but the 12% platinum discount offset that a little.
My life is complete now I have the ultimate cycling gadget.!"

"I am doing an end to end in May with a small group and Wiggle kindly assisted us with a good discount on these jerseys as we needed this colour blue.
I am 5'10", 40 chest and 32 waist, and nearly 12 stone. The large is a good fit, medium would have been too small. I always go one size up with DHB and the fit is perfect, hence the 5 stars for fit.
The zip operates smoothly and feels strong. Managed to get plenty into the rear pockets as well without it losing too much shape or feeling uncomfortable. Jersey looks good on, although it is slightly shorter in length at the front than other jerseys I have.
Worn several times in fair to warm weather so far and it keeps me cool and gets rid of excess heat and moisture. I didn't overheat when hauling myself up some monster hills near to where I live.
A great product for the price."

""I bought a Gatorskin to replace a Pro4 endurance that got a flat within 50 miles of fitting. However, I still kept a Pro4 on the front and am able to compare the two tyres while writing this review.
The Gatorskin went onto my rims easy enough with no drama and I was back on the road in no time. there is a tread direction and an arrow on the sidewall to show you which way to fit.
The Gatorskin and the Pro4 tyre is still going strong after 1500 or so miles with no signs of cuts or extreme wear. I have not had a further puncture in nearly a year.
It has got me through a long cold winter on the roads, and I have never felt like the tyre could not handle the road conditions. Looking at the Gatorskin and the Pro 4 they both appear to be still going strong and if it ain't broke don't fix it!!
Weight of tyre is not an issue for me as I am riding on bombproof Mavics. Gotta say the Gatorskin has lived up to the reputation of being reliable and long lasting."

""Been using my Nano leg warmers with matching arm warmers and Gabba jersey. I find the large fits my arms and legs fine. I am 5'10 and have typical cyclists legs, ie well defined and slim.
The silicon grippers hold everything in place perfectly, there is no irritation from the seam, the zip stays closed and does not cause any issues around my socks or overshoes, and there is no bunching behind the knees.
I have been out in both wind and rain without either feeling cold or wet underneath the protective layer. I got filthy with road spray during one ride and popped them into the washing machine with no adverse effects on looks or performance next time I went out.
I find the Castelli stuff really does work as advertised, and is robust and reliable""

"I have just bought a Gabba in black from Wiggle with a great discount. I looked at one last year but went for the Sanremo Thermosuit instead, which kept me so warm and dry all winter I didn't need to use the turbo trainer at all.. However, winter is over so time to buy a Gabba and see what all the fuss is about.
I am 5'10" 11 1/2 stone and 39 inch chest and 32 inch waist. Medium was too small, but the large fits fine- not too tightly stretched. The jersey is extremely well made and the windstopper fabric feels soft against your body and is not restrictive. The fit is great with no spare material to flap about and spoil the aero cut.
Nice Silver/white logo across the chest and of course the obligatory scorpions on the arms,chest and back. There is a long flap at the back which completely covers the backside, and the pockets have eyelets in to let any rainwater out. Zip is easy to move with a gloved hand and feels strong.
It has not rained in the UK for a couple of weeks, but tried it out in 4 degrees C with a strong wind whipping around yesterday. Paired with some Nanoflex arm and leg warmers I was kept protected from the wind, warm, and yet enough ventilation going on to avoid overheat or excessive sweat.
Very comfortable on and got some (I think) complimentary looks from other road users. I have to say the jersey looks great as well, it just exudes Castelli style and quality.
I am actually looking forward to some heavy rain!!"

Entry level at Mavic doesn't mean low end. This wheelset provides you with top Mavic technologies.
 

Mavic Aksium Black Clincher Wheelset, Are these compatiable with 8 speed shimano cassette?

Best answer
Top 50 Contributor
Top 50 Contributor
Mavic wheels come with a spacer which needs to go on before the cassette. This will be fitted to the wheels already if they're currently in use. In addition to this, there will be a spacer that goes behind a 10 speed cassette. This is NOT required with the 8 speed cassette.

So the short answer is YES.
